U.S., Oct. 7 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T07208994) titled 'Pathways to Equitable Access to Kidney Transplantation in Spain: A Transformative Mixed-methods Study Protocol' on June 27.
Brief Summary: Introduction. Chronic kidney disease (CKD) affects 10%-15% of the global population and is projected to become the fifth leading cause of years of life lost by 2040. Despite the benefits of kidney transplantation (KT), access remains inequitable. In Spain, which leads the world in KT rates per million population, disparities may persist due to structural, territorial, and professional barriers.
